Logo for Peter B. Eckel Dmd

Find your perfect dentist.

Frequently asked questions

What languages do the doctors at Peter B. Eckel Dmd speak?

Peter B. Eckel Dmd provides services in English. Click here to explore available appointments!

Is Peter B. Eckel Dmd accepting new patients?

Peter B. Eckel Dmd is not currently accepting new patients through Opencare. Please contact the office directly to book an appointment or use Opencare to book an appointment at a practice near you!

Does Peter B. Eckel Dmd offer teeth whitening?

Yes, Peter B. Eckel Dmd offers teeth whitening services.

Does Peter B. Eckel Dmd offer check up and cleanings?

Yes, Peter B. Eckel Dmd offers regular check up and cleaning services.

Other Nearby Offices

Joseph Downing, D.M.D.
36 Country Club Road, Suite 821
Gilford, New Hampshire
Center for Contemporary Dentistry
(3)
14 Bishop Road
Belmont, New Hampshire